PCF8563 Real-time clock/calendar

 

General description

The PCF8563 is a CMOS real-time clock/calendar optimized for low power consumption. A programmable clock output, interrupt output and voltage-low detector are also provided. All address and data are transferred serially via a two-line bidirectional I2C-bus. Maximum bus speed is 400 kbits/s. The built-in word address register is incremented automatically after each written or read data byte.

 

Features

■ Provides year, month, day, weekday, hours, minutes and seconds based on 32.768 kHz quartz crystal

■ Century flag

■ Wide operating supply voltage range: 1.0 to 5.5 V

■ Low back-up current; typical 0.25 µA at VDD = 3.0 V and Tamb = 25 °C

■ 400 kHz two-wire I2C-bus interface (at VDD = 1.8 to 5.5 V)

■ Programmable clock output for peripheral devices: 32.768 kHz, 1024 Hz, 32 Hz and 1 Hz

 

■ Alarm and timer functions

■ Voltage-low detector

■ Integrated oscillator capacitor

■ Internal power-on reset

■ I 2C-bus slave address: read A3H; write A2H

■ Open drain interrupt pin.

 

Applications

■ Mobile telephones

■ Portable instruments

■ Fax machines

■ Battery powered products.

 

Quick reference data

Symbol Parameter Conditions Min Max  Unit
VDD supply voltage operating mode I2C-bus inactive; Tamb = 25 °C 1.0 5.5 V
I 2C-bus active; fSCL = 400 kHz; Tamb = −40 to +85 °C 1.8 5.5 V
IDD supply current; timer and CLKOUT disabled fSCL = 400 kHz - 800 µA
fSCL = 100 kHz - 200 µA
fSCL = 0 Hz; Tamb = 25 °C      
VDD = 5 V - 550 nA
VDD = 2 V - 450 nA
Tamb operating ambient temperature   -40 +85 °C
Tstg storage temperature   -65 +150 °C

 

Limiting values

In accordance with the Absolute Maximum Rating System (IEC 60134).

Symbol Parameter Min Max Unit
VDD supply voltage -0.5 +6.5 V
IDD supply current -50 +50 mA
VI input voltage on inputs SCL and SDA -0.5 6.5 V
input voltage on input OSCI -0.5 VDD + 0.5 V
VO output voltage on outputs CLKOUT and INT -0.5 6.5 V
II DC input current at any input -10 +10 mA
IO DC output current at any output -10 +10 mA
Ptot total power dissipation - 300 mW
Tamb operating ambient temperature -40 +85 °C
Tstg storage temperature -65 +150 °C
